I think you found what I personally found, and I know another online tester did as well, and that is the TS3 sits in the neutral position very very very slightly shut and it is more likely to produce a draw. Either putting the surefit to fade or flatting the lie mentally gives you the ability to go at it normally without worrying it will turn over too much. I ended up with both surefit to fade and flat lie - and the combo really allows you the peace of mind + the added mass behind a slight toe strike, to go at it. There is something about that driver that seems to produce 2200rpms spin for most people. If you can manage your game on course with lower spin then the Rogue Sub Zero is a great choice - otherwise 2200 is a great consistent zone.
